Choosing between Atlanta, USA and Las Vegas, USA for your next getaway depends entirely on the experience you're seeking. Atlanta, a vibrant Southern metropolis, offers a rich tapestry of history, culture, and burgeoning culinary scenes, all set against a backdrop of lush green spaces and a surprisingly dynamic urban landscape. It's a city that rewards exploration, from its historic landmarks to its innovative food halls and lively neighborhoods.
On the other hand, Las Vegas is synonymous with unparalleled entertainment, dazzling lights, and a unique brand of adult-focused fun. It's a city that pulsates with energy, offering world-class casinos, spectacular shows, and an endless array of dining options. While both cities offer distinct advantages, your ideal destination hinges on whether you crave a dose of Southern charm and cultural immersion or the electrifying allure of the desert entertainment capital.
| Month | Atlanta, USA High | Atlanta, USA Rain | Las Vegas, USA High | Las Vegas, USA Rain |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Jan | 50°F | 100mm | 57°F | 12mm |
| Feb | 54°F | 110mm | 63°F | 14mm |
| Mar | 63°F | 120mm | 70°F | 11mm |
| Apr | 72°F | 90mm | 79°F | 7mm |
| May | 79°F | 100mm | 88°F | 5mm |
| Jun | 86°F | 100mm | 99°F | 3mm |
| Jul | 88°F | 130mm | 102°F | 10mm |
| Aug | 86°F | 110mm | 100°F | 11mm |
| Sep | 81°F | 100mm | 93°F | 10mm |
| Oct | 72°F | 80mm | 81°F | 15mm |
| Nov | 61°F | 90mm | 66°F | 15mm |
| Dec | 52°F | 100mm | 57°F | 12mm |
For Atlanta, the spring (April-June) and fall (September-October) offer the most pleasant temperatures for exploring its parks and neighborhoods. Las Vegas is best enjoyed during the shoulder seasons of spring (March-May) and fall (September-November) to avoid the intense summer heat and enjoy comfortable outdoor activities and the vibrant city atmosphere.
